Output 45ec73fb651beb7201f59cdf41c799ea4c7d2fe9675ff0d4e2f7b59bf624e3e0:3

value
53743
script pubkey
OP_0 OP_PUSHBYTES_20 9dcd659ad7600de2a54647177d2fe2a99a3b9b9c
address
bc1qnhxktxkhvqx79f2xguth6tlz4xdrhxuualn5k6
transaction
45ec73fb651beb7201f59cdf41c799ea4c7d2fe9675ff0d4e2f7b59bf624e3e0
confirmations
192663
spent
true